Description

Depiction of the Home Economics Club derived from the Diorama, the student yearbook.

First Row: Arlene Cheatham, Gail Minor, State Vice-President, Mædrue Daniel, Publicity Chairman, Wanda Anderson, President, Nancy Clemmons, Secretary, Frances Henson, Reporter,  Letha Smith, Mrs. Rasch, Sponsor. Second Row: Joan Young, Nita Hipps, Eva Mongomery, Faye Shelton, Sybil Persall, Ruth Rhodes, Carolyn Hanback, Maxine Redmond, Rita Hipps, Elizabeth Mitchell.

According to the Diorama, "The Mary Willis Huff Home Economics Club was established in 1948 for the promotion of interest in home economics as a profession and in improved practices in homemaking and everyday living. It is open to all home economics majors."
